A BILL TO BE ENTITLED
 
AN ACT
 
  relating to parental notification regarding public school teacher
  qualifications.
         B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S:
         SECTION 1.  Section 21.057(e), Education Code, is amended to
  read as follows:
         (e)  This section does not apply if a school is required in
  accordance with Section 1006 [1111(h)(6)(B)(ii)], Every Student
  Succeeds Act (20 U.S.C. Section 6312(e)(1)(B)(ii)) [No Child Left
  Behind Act of 2001 (20 U.S.C. Section 6311), and its subsequent
  amendments], to provide notice to a parent or guardian regarding a
  teacher who does not meet certification requirements at the grade
  level and subject area in which the teacher is assigned [is not
  highly qualified], provided the school provides notice as required
  by that Act.
         SECTION 2.  This Act takes effect immediately if it receives
  a vote of two-thirds of all the members elected to each house, as
  provided by Section 39, Article III, Texas Constitution.  If this
  Act does not receive the vote necessary for immediate effect, this
  Act takes effect September 1, 2017.
